    Spc. Karessa Hinton, a chemical operations specialist with the 299th chemical biological radiological nuclear and explosive (CBRNE) team out of Maysville, Ky., performs a water decontamination of a mock casualty during a training exercise at Muscatatuck Urban Training Center in Butlerville, Ind. May 24. The 299th was training to become validated as part of the Kentucky National Guard's Chemical Biological Radiological Nuclear high-yield Explosive Enhanced Response Force Package (CERFP) which trains Guardsmen on how to react and respond to a CBRNE attack.
